| CVE-2020-10148 | Authentication Bypass in SolarWinds Orion API (CVE-2020-10148) The SolarWinds Orion API contains a critical authentication bypass (CWE-288/CWE-306, CVSS 9.8) that allows a remote, unauthenticated attacker to execute API commands on the Orion Platform. It is triggered by specially crafted requests to the Orion API that reach endpoints with authorization skipped, requiring no privileges or user interaction. By issuing these API commands, an attacker can take control of the SolarWinds instance; in observed intrusions, the flaw was used to install the SUPERNOVA webshell on Orion servers. Any organization running Orion Platform 2019.4 HF 5, 2020.2 with no hotfix installed, or 2020.2 HF 1 is affected. Exploitation is in the wild: the flaw is listed in CISA's KEV (added 2021-11-03), has been linked to the China-nexus actor DEV-0322 per public reporting, and EPSS assigns it a 92% probability of exploitation within 30 days. Do: Apply the Orion Platform updates/hotfixes per SolarWinds' instructions and move all installations off the affected builds (2019.4 HF 5, 2020.2 without hotfix, 2020.2 HF 1). Until patched, restrict access to the Orion web console and API to trusted networks only. Hunt for compromise by checking for the SUPERNOVA webshell in the Orion web root and reviewing API logs for unauthenticated API command execution. | 9.8 | 92% | KEV |

| CVE-2021-35211 | Unauthenticated RCE (Remote Memory Escape) in SolarWinds Serv-U Microsoft researchers discovered a remote code execution flaw in SolarWinds Serv-U, an out-of-bounds write (CWE-787) described as a "Remote Memory Escape" in the Windows-based Serv-U products. A remote, unauthenticated attacker can trigger the flaw over the network against servers running a version before 15.2.3 HF2 and gain privileged access to the machine hosting Serv-U, with a maximum CVSS 10.0 score reflecting no required privileges, no user interaction, and impact beyond the application's security scope. Both Serv-U Managed File Transfer and Serv-U Secure FTP for Windows are affected. The vulnerability has been exploited in the wild: Microsoft attributed July 2021 attacks exploiting the Serv-U zero-day to Chinese threat actors, later warned of an uptick in exploitation attempts, and the flaw was added to CISA KEV on 2021-11-03 with known ransomware use. Do: Upgrade Serv-U to 15.2.3 Hotfix 2 (HF2) or later per SolarWinds' instructions immediately, as the flaw is in CISA KEV with known exploitation including ransomware use. Audit Serv-U servers and their logs for signs of exploitation or compromise, and restrict internet exposure of Serv-U/FTP and SSH ports to trusted parties. | 10.0 | 91% | KEV ransomware |

Microsoft said today that the recent wave of attacks that have targeted SolarWinds file transfer servers are the work of a Chinese hacking group the company has been tracking under the name of DEV-0322. News of the attacks first surfaced on Friday, July 9, when embattled software provider SolarWinds released a security update to patch a zero-day vulnerability in its Serv-U technology that was being exploited in the wild. At the time, SolarWinds said it learned of the zero-day (CVE-2021-35211) and the ongoing attacks from Microsoft but did not release any additional details beyond the Serv-U patch (v15.2.3 HF2). Initially, Microsoft declined to comment following the SolarWinds patch in emails sent by The Record. However, following pressure from the cyber-security community on Tuesday, which kept asking the OS maker for additional details so they could deploy countermeasures to detect and block ongoing attacks, Microsoft published a blog post today with an in-depth description of the zero-day's entire exploitation chain. According to the report, Microsoft said it discovered the DEV-0322 attacks after its Defender antivirus began detecting malicious processes spawning from Serv-U's main application, which eventually led its security team to investigate and discover the zero-day and the ongoing attacks. While Microsoft couldn't comment on the targets of this most recent campaign, the OS maker said that past DEV-0322 attacks had targeted software companies and entities in the US Defense Industrial Base Sector. These attacks also mark the second time that a Chinese hacking group has abused SolarWinds software to breach corporate and government networks. Back in December 2020, while the Russian-orchestrated SolarWinds supply chain attack was coming to light, Chinese hacking groups were also busy abusing the CVE-2020-10148 vulnerability to install web shells on SolarWinds Orion IT monitoring platforms. Because the CVE-2020-10148 came to light during the more broad supply chain investigation, it took security firms some time to separate the two incidents and eventually make the connection to a Chinese group tracked as Spiral. All in all, companies that run SolarWinds Serv-U file transfer servers can protect themselves against DEV-022 attacks by either installing the company's patch or by disabling SSH access to the server, which is how the group is compromising servers. According to a Censys search query, there are more than 8,200 SolarWinds Serv-U systems exposing their SSH port online, a number that had remained steady since last week, when the patches were released.DEV-0322 previously targeted the US Defense Industrial Base
